Hello, and welcome to this online PowerInspect class.
00:12
Whether you're new to PowerInspect's metrology, this course will introduce you to the key concepts of PowerInspect by focusing on a basic inspection workflow.
00:23
Whether you are working on the training example in this class or complex components, the inspection process will be the same, basic workflow every time.
00:31
And this will ensure that your part is measured as accurately and as efficiently as possible.
00:38
So, before we jump into any specifics, let's take some time to outline and discuss the workflow that we'll be following throughout the rest of this class.
00:47
The first step in the workflow is device setup.
00:50
Here you will be able to connect to your device, select the correct protocol to allow to communicate with PowerInspect, and calibrate it, to ensure that any measurements that are created will be valid and accurate.
01:02
Once your device has been setup, we can start using the PowerInspect software by opening a new document.
01:09
Whether you're working from a CAD model or a drawing, PowerInspect has a helpful wizard that would take you through the steps of starting a new project.
01:17
With your project setup, the component needs to be aligned relative to your datum.
01:23
Correctly aligning a component is essential to getting accurate measurement results and PowerInspect has a number of different alignment strategies.
01:33
Once your part has been aligned, you can start measuring different features in surface form.
01:38
With the part measured, PowerInspect enables you to view and customize an inspection report to communicate either internally or externally.
01:47
At this stage, you are also able to go back and realign and re-measure if you're unhappy with any aspects of your results.
01:55
You should pick up on this workflow fairly quickly because we'll be utilizing it throughout this class to guide us through inspecting the components.
02:04
So, with all that in mind, let's start utilizing our workflow by starting on our first PowerInspect project in lesson 1.
